Formula: Debt/Assets = Total Debt / Total Assets × 100
Debt/Assets vs Debt/Equity:
- Debt/Assets: Shows % of assets funded by creditors (bounded 0-100%)
- Debt/Equity: Shows debt relative to shareholder investment (can exceed 100%)
- Both measure leverage but from different perspectives
Industry context matters: Capital-intensive industries (utilities, real estate) typically have higher Debt/Assets ratios than tech companies.

About Byrna Technologies Inc.
Byrna Technologies Inc. (BYRN) specializes in less-lethal defense technology, focusing on the creation and manufacturing of non-lethal munitions and associated security equipment. The company's primary offerings include a line of Byrna-branded handheld personal protection instruments, such as the Byrna SD and Byrna SD .68 caliber models, which are specifically designed for both civilians and private security professionals. Complementing these devices, Byrna also provides related products like Byrna HD magazines, shoulder-fired launchers, and various projectiles. Its comprehensive catalog further extends to a range of accessories and safety gear, notably the Byrna Banshee, Byrna Shield, compressed carbon dioxide cartridges, aiming systems, holsters, and branded apparel. Incorporated in 2005 and headquartered in Andover, Massachusetts, the firm conducts its business in the United States and South Africa. It previously operated as Security Devices International, Inc., changing its name to Byrna Technologies Inc. in March 2020.
